It’s going to be interesting to see how Cash Fruits performs and what type of market it carves out for itself in the VLT sector. “Through experience we are starting to understand the types of locations that work, as opposed to those that under- perform in regards to VLT mini-casino sites,” described Mr. Ronchi. “300- 400sq.m. is about the right size for a VLT location, which must also have the right ambience and an upmarket atmosphere to create the right player experience. 150m locations are simply big bars, which have failed to attract female players and so ultimately have failed to perform as strongly.”


While there remain concerns that the process of implementation has been slow, with 28,000 of the 56,000 machines in the marketplaces after the first year, Mr. Ronchi believes the process will in fact slow dramatically from this point forward. "We have seen the installation of 50 per cent of the allocation of VLT machines in 12 months,” explained Mr. Ronchi. "However, most of this allocation has been installed into existing sites. The process to authorise and open a new mini-casino location can take six month to one year. It will take much longer to site the remaining 50 per cent of VLTs.”

There appears no quick alternative to siting VLTs in the market. Locations that have opened without the adequate space, mini-casino atmosphere or right mix of service and image, have been expensive failures. The maxim of ‘location, location, location’ remains as important in the VLT market as elsewhere, but the right type of location to match the product to the customer has proved to be equally important. Just as the VLT jackpot has proved to be the driver for high level play, the high level experience also applies to the environment. Locations with 20-30 machines are significantly under performing those with 100-150 terminals.


VLT players are looking for the casino experience and are prepared to ignore the same machine in ‘big bar’ locations, while driving substantial revenue through mini-casino locations. "The expectation of turnover during this period has greatly exceeded our business plan by 50 per cent,” described Mr. Ronchi of the locations that match player expectations. “We believed the market would sustain revenues per device of €1,000 per day, when in fact VLTs are generating €1,600 per day, which is a significant difference. It is going to take longer than expected to develop this mini-casino market, but the rewards are significant when the offer is right.”
